Those who illegally interfere in activities of journalists in Azerbaijan to be fined up to $353
Milli Majlis
- 19 January, 2023
- 06:19
An amendment is proposed to be made in the Code of Administrative Offenses on intervenion in the professional activities of journalists in Azerbaijan, Report informs.
According to the amendment, those who illegally intervene in the professional activities of journalists will be fined from 300 to 600 manats ($176.47-352.94).
